RASPBERRIES WITH RICOTTA CREAM

Provided by Bobby Flay

Categories     dessert

Time 40m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 cup part-skim ricotta cheese
2 tablespoons light brown sugar
2 tablespoons orange liqueur, (recommended: Grand Marnier) or fresh orange juice
1 pint raspberries
Mint sprigs

Steps:

  • Place the ricotta in a small strainer set over a bowl and refrigerate for 30 minutes to drain the excess liquid.
  • Transfer the drained ricotta to a food processor or blender, add the brown sugar and orange liqueur and process until smooth. (The ricotta mixture can be made up to 8 hours in advance and covered and kept refrigerated.)
  • Divide the raspberries among 4 dessert bowls and top each with a 1/4 cup of the ricotta mixture. Add a splash of the orange liqueur or juice, and garnish with mint sprigs.
